Chrysler announced last week that Ram would build the first straight-from-factory CNG truck in its history. The first batch of heavy duty 2500s will hit showrooms this summer, a major move for the automaker as it tries to blunt high gasoline prices for its customers. Q: What are the health and environmental effects of diesel exhaust?
A: Diesel particulate matter (PM) can penetrate deep into the lungs and pose serious health risks, including lung cancer, aggravated asthma, chronic bronchitis, and increased respiratory symptoms. One advantage that an electric motor has is that it is relatively small compared to a gasoline engine with the same capacity. Another adavantage is that because of the high torque you don’t need a gearbox.
